The material used to make them is a major element in their longevity. Hinges made of strong materials such as brass, stainless steel or zinc-aluminum alloys are resistant to wear, corrosion and extreme weather conditions. They also can support heavier window sashes which reduces the stress on the hinges.

In addition to the material in addition to the material, the design of hinges is also a factor in their longevity. Hinges with multiple bearing points help distribute the weight of the sash more evenly, which prevents the hinges from prematurely wearing out or causing damage. Hinges that can be adjusted in tension permit you to alter the amount of pressure applied to the sash.

Energy efficiency

The quality of hinges can play a major role in determining the energy efficiency of a window. This is because hinges' quality determines whether they create gaps between the frame and sash which let warm air escape in the winter and cold air to get in during the summer, contributing to increased energy bills. Windows hinges that are properly installed and matched make sure that windows are sealed tightly. This can reduce energy consumption and minimizes air flow.

The energy efficiency of sash window hinges depends on the material, style, and performance. Most popular are hinges made of stainless steel, brass, or aluminum because they are durable and can withstand long-term use. They are light and have a sleek look. They are also prone to rust, particularly in damp conditions. It is important to select a hinge that is durable and designed to stand up to different weather conditions and climates.

Awning Windows require hinges made specifically to serve this for this purpose. Friction hinges consist of two plates interconnected, one secured to the frame, and the other attached to the sash are a preferred choice for this type of window due to their the highest stability and can keep the window in place at any angle. They are also perfect for regions that are windy, since they allow the sash remain solidly in place even when the window has been fully opened.

Hinges with thermal breaks or insulating materials reduce the transfer of heat through them. This decreases the chance of thermal bridging, which occurs when heat bypasses insulation and is transferred directly to the hinge mechanism. The resultant reduction in air leakage and drafts ensures a consistent indoor temperature and improves comfort for the occupants and reduces cooling and heating costs.
